我想爲.NET 3.5應用程序禁用部分或全部系統聲音。您可以禁用.NET應用程序的系統聲音嗎?
我找不到System.Media.SystemSounds
的任何信息,它會關閉用戶通過控制面板選擇的聲音設置。
[編輯] 這是對於我們顯示的特定消息框中的Exlamation類型的聲音更多。真的會喜歡靜音的表單或對話框。
我想爲.NET 3.5應用程序禁用部分或全部系統聲音。您可以禁用.NET應用程序的系統聲音嗎?
我找不到System.Media.SystemSounds
的任何信息,它會關閉用戶通過控制面板選擇的聲音設置。
[編輯] 這是對於我們顯示的特定消息框中的Exlamation類型的聲音更多。真的會喜歡靜音的表單或對話框。
按照定義,它們是系統聲音,而不是應用程序聲音。因此禁用所有這些應用程序也會禁用它們以用於其他應用程序。您是否想要使用任意禁用所有系統聲音的應用程序?
不知道哪個特定系統聽起來會失效,除了簡單地將揚聲器靜音之外,不可能給您更直接的答案。
我相信OP是問你是否可以標記應用程序,使Windows不會產生系統聲音。 – Superbest
如果您正在使用用戶已配置發出聲音的系統功能,您爲什麼要這麼做? –
無法抵擋......它被稱爲靜音按鈕:) – DRapp
如果您希望在文本框中禁用* ding *,則可以使用以下解決方案。 http://stackoverflow.com/questions/6290967/stop-the-ding-when-pressing-enter –